×

shuttle imaging radar meaning in Chinese

航天成象雷达

Related Words

  1. hotel shuttle
  2. shuttle tram
  3. broken shuttle
  4. shuttle die
  5. shuttle stabilizer
  6. shuttle hurdle
  7. shuttle race
  8. shuttle bus
  9. wheel shuttle
  10. shuttle conveyer
  11. shuttle head embroidery machines
  12. shuttle hurdle
  13. shuttle kiln
  14. shuttle loom
PC Version

Copyright © 2018 WordTech Co.